Re: pagination in the Tarnwick audit-log viewer — plugin authors shouldn't hardcode page sizes; the viewer clamps anything outside the allowed range and silently truncates. Please read these from the exported config instead of duplicating them. Also note the scroll cursor expires, so long-running exports must refresh it. The clamped values are defined here.

constants for bawif-kawif:
QUOTAS = {
    "ulaael": 5,
    "holael": 10,
}

Subject: Gaugelet sidecar — release candidate ready

Hi all, the Gaugelet metrics-aggregation sidecar is ready for the Thornvale rollout. This cut fixes the double-counting of histogram buckets under pod restarts and lowers memory ceiling to 128Mi. Soak ran 48 hours on staging with no drift against the reference aggregator. Release manager: please schedule the stage-two deploy. The build token for this candidate is below.

pipeline stamp: htk3_69f

Subject: Quickstore 4.2 — bloom filter now fronts the KV layer

Plugin authors: starting with this release, Quickstore places a bloom filter ahead of the key-value store. Negative lookups return faster; false positives fall through safely. No API changes are required on your side. Verify your plugin against the staging build referenced below.

session token of fahif-tadup = htk3_9c7

Quarterly Planning Note — FX Hedging. Finance team, Orvale Systems. Decision: hedge 70% of forecast Lorin-mark exposure for Q3–Q4 via forwards; options rejected on cost. Trigger for the remaining 30% is a 2% adverse move. Counterparty limits unchanged. Treasury executes Monday; accounting to confirm hedge designation same week. Report variances weekly to the planning desk. Rationale ties to the strategic position summarized in the confidential note below.

board note of kageg-bahof: The renewal with Holwynax Holdings closes at $2 million a year, 5 percent below the last contract. Project Ulaath slips by two quarters because of the supplier delay.